Man charged in crime spree pleads guilty

NewsCentral Staff

MACON, Ga. (AP) - A man says he's guilty of robbing a south Georgia bank with his brother and sister during a crime spree that started with a police chase in Florida and ended in a shootout in Colorado.

Dylan Dougherty (DOCK-uhr-tee) Stanley pleaded guilty Friday in U.S. District Court in Macon to charges that he helped his siblings rob Certus Bank in Valdosta last year and fired an assault rifle into the bank's ceiling.

The 27-year-old suspect from Zephyrhills, Fla., reached a plea deal with prosecutors, as his two siblings did last month. Terms were not disclosed. All three will be sentenced in December.

The siblings pleaded guilty to Colorado charges last August. They still face charges in Florida, where authorities say they shot at a police officer during a high-speed chase
